It sounds like a good idea in theory. But half of doctors surveyed say they do not report incompetent colleagues or serious medical errors.  The startling revelation appears in the Annals of Internal Medicine. In the survey 3,504 practicing doctors were asked whether they understand and support professional standards.  93 percent of doctors responding believe one should always alert authorities when facing potential medical malpractice. But in reality only 55 percent said they always did so.
